Concerns Over the Exclusion of Palestine in Gaza Peace Talks

The Secretary-General of the Palestinian National Initiative has expressed significant concern regarding the recent peace conference in Washington chaired by President Donald Trump. He highlighted a troubling trend aimed at separating the fate of Gaza not only from the West Bank but also from the broader Palestinian issue.

During this conference Israel was officially represented despite its Prime Minister facing war crime allegations from the International Criminal Court. In stark contrast Palestine as the central party in the conflict was inadequately represented. Only the head of the National Committee managing Gaza was permitted to speak and even then his remarks were confined to humanitarian and operational matters within the Gaza Strip.
